Pagani Huayra the name could be "Da Vinci"

Horacio Pagani has revealed in an interview with Autoblog. com. ar unusual detail about the genesis of the Pagani Huayra. Horacio was in fact wanted to call the new sports "Da Vinci", but a previous constraint on the rights he was unable to proceed and it was decided to use the initials Huayra, linked to two very different meanings: one is the name of the wind-language Quechua, the other a citation Argentina Heriberto Pronello eponymous prototype, developed in collaboration with Ford in 1969.

Pagani has also confirmed the birth of a Roadster version in 2014 and especially the great interest already hatched inside the Huayra: 60 orders were collected in 3 weeks already, and many other customers are interested in the car, powered by a 6.0 V12 biturbo made Mercedes and capable of more than 700 bhp and 1000 Nm
